A recent incident in Enfield has caught the attention of social media and local news, as a man in his twenties was reportedly stabbed and left in serious condition. According to a tweet from Norman Brennan, the incident took place at Market Place around 2:10 AM. The Metropolitan Police responded promptly, treating the victim at the scene before rushing him to the hospital. As of now, there have been no arrests made in connection with the incident, which leaves many questions unanswered.

What Happened in Enfield?

In the early hours of yesterday morning, a man in his 20s was stabbed and suffered serious injuries in Enfield, specifically in the busy Market Place area. The incident occurred around 2:10 AM, prompting an immediate response from the MET Police. Upon arrival, officers found the victim in dire need of medical attention. He was treated at the scene before being rushed to the hospital, where he remains in serious condition. The urgency of the situation was palpable, as police and medical personnel worked swiftly to save his life. As of now, there have been no arrests made in connection with the attack, which adds to the growing concern regarding public safety in London.

How Are Authorities Responding to the Knife Crime Epidemic?

In response to the alarming rise in knife crime, authorities in London have implemented various strategies aimed at curbing this violence. Initiatives include increased police patrols in high-risk areas, community outreach programs, and educational campaigns targeting young people. The MET Police have been particularly proactive, conducting operations designed to remove knives from the streets and apprehend offenders. Furthermore, partnerships with local organizations aim to provide support and mentorship to at-risk youth, steering them away from a life of crime. A notable example of such an initiative is the London Knife Crime Strategy, which outlines a comprehensive approach to tackle the issue from multiple angles. Although these efforts are commendable, many community members remain skeptical about their effectiveness, especially in light of recent incidents like the one in Enfield.
